Heritage has some material on this, and I’ve done some simple calculations, too. Many assume proper storage would be a modest adder to green power, or maybe even double the cost. But that is simply not true–the cost of battery storage to cover a few days of dark, calm conditions is a couple orders of magnitude on top of the green power $$. Yes, 50x or more. Which makes a complete conventional fuel burning power plant a cheaper backup than any significant capacity battery storage.

The calculations get even worse when trying to size the storage to level the output across an entire year.

(And if you have to build a complete fuel-burning plant as backup, at max capacity, why bother building any green power in the first place?)
